I was struggling a bit this summer to get back up to 10k as I want to try for further, maybe 10 miles. Then I saw the virtual summer 10k for kidney research so that was my incentive! I managed the 10k last week and carried on for another mile so 7 miles run in 1hr 22. This week I did 4.5 miles Monday so today I challenged myself to 7 miles again to see if I could do it. Eldest daughter 8 yrs was a whippet on her bike and out the door before I had time for stretching! Off we went on a new route for 7 miles. There was a quick slurp stop at 2.7 miles, an almost got run over stop at 4.5 miles, a stinky bin lorry blocking our way at 5 miles before we finally hit 7 miles in 1hr 15. I can do it! My legs felt tired so I need to strengthen them. I would like to increase to 10 miles slowly but worry that I am not strong enough yet.........
